Abstract

Mathematics Mathematics, Applied Operations Research & Management Science Physical Sciences Science & Technology Technology
We study a variety of Wasserstein distributionally robust optimization (WDRO) problems where the distributions in the ambiguity set are chosen by constraining their Wasserstein discrepancies to the empirical distribution. Using the notion of weak Lipschitz property, we develop a flexible framework to derive lower and upper bounds for the corresponding worst-case loss quantity and propose sufficient conditions under which this quantity coincides with its regularization scheme counterpart. Our constructive methodology and elementary analysis also directly characterize the closed-form of the approximate worst-case distribution. Extensive applications show that our framework can be used to establish theoretical results for various problems, including regression, classification and risk measure problems. We believe that the flexible framework developed here can serve as a convenient tool for analysing other WDRO problems.
